Abstract

A self-lubricating bearing assembly comprising a bearing support structure with an oil passage formed therein, a rotating oil drive drum having a peripheral wall and being substantially open on one side thereof, and a structure and lubrication teaspoon valve comprising at least one lubrication teaspoon member for collecting oil from within the oil drive drum, and an oil passage for conveying oil from the lubrication teaspoon member to said passage step. oil, said lubricating teaspoon member curving from the discharge end to the collecting end thereof, in a direction opposite to the direction of rotation of the oil supply drum, and having its collection end arranged in close proximity and substantially tangential to the inner surface of said peripheral wall, and its discharge end substantially tangential to the bottom surface of said oil duct.
